hi everyone
is there a nice elegant way to avoid repeating the same test condition when nesting multiple IF?

I mean, my condition is a long formula which must be equal to something. 4 different results are possible. So 3 nested IF. At the moment I write again my long formula to be tested in each IF.
If there is a way to use "OR" instead, I could avoid it
example:
IF(condition=1;true;(if(condition=2;true;(if(condi tion=3;true;....
and so on

is there a way to bring "condition" outside???
